    Nutrition: The Building Block of Health

    Proper nutrition is fundamental to children’s growth and development. A balanced diet provides the essential nutrients that support physical growth, cognitive development, and immune function. Here are some important aspects to consider:

    Balanced Diet

    A balanced diet for children should include:

    Fruits and Vegetables: Aim for a variety of colors to ensure a range of nutrients. These provide vitamins, minerals, and fiber.

    Whole Grains: Foods like whole wheat bread, brown rice, and oats are rich in essential nutrients and fiber.

    Protein: Essential for growth and development, good sources include lean meats, poultry, fish, beans, and nuts.

    Dairy: Provides calcium and vitamin D for bone health. Choose low-fat or fat-free options when possible.

    Healthy Fats: Found in avocados, nuts, seeds, and olive oil, these fats are important for brain development.

    Hydration

    Water is crucial for maintaining bodily functions. Encourage children to drink water regularly and limit sugary drinks, which can lead to obesity and dental problems.

    Portion Control

    Teaching children about portion sizes can help prevent overeating and promote a healthy relationship with food. Use smaller plates and avoid forcing children to eat when they are not hungry.

    Physical Activity: Moving Towards a Healthy Lifestyle

    Regular physical activity is vital for maintaining a healthy weight, building strong bones and muscles, and promoting mental well-being. Here are some tips to incorporate more physical activity into children’s lives:

    Daily Exercise

    Children should aim for at least 60 minutes of moderate to vigorous physical activity each day. This can include:

    Outdoor Play: Encourage activities like running, biking, and playing sports.

    Structured Sports: Participation in team sports such as soccer, basketball, or swimming.

    Family Activities: Engage in family outings that involve physical activity, such as hiking or walking the dog.

    Limiting Screen Time

    Excessive screen time can lead to a sedentary lifestyle and associated health issues. Set limits on the use of televisions, computers, and mobile devices, and encourage active play instead.

    Mental Health: Nurturing Emotional Well-being

    Mental health is as important as physical health. Children need a supportive environment to develop resilience, cope with stress, and build self-esteem. Consider the following strategies:

    Open Communication

    Create a safe space for children to express their feelings. Listen actively and validate their emotions, helping them to navigate complex feelings.

    Stress Management

    Teach children healthy ways to manage stress, such as through deep breathing exercises, mindfulness practices, or engaging in hobbies they enjoy.

    Social Connections

    Foster strong social connections by encouraging friendships and positive relationships with peers and family members. Social support is crucial for emotional development.

    Preventive Healthcare: Regular Check-ups and Vaccinations

    Preventive healthcare helps identify and address potential health issues before they become serious. Ensure children receive regular medical check-ups and stay up-to-date with vaccinations:

    Routine Check-ups

    Schedule regular visits with a pediatrician to monitor growth, development, and general health. These check-ups can help detect issues early and provide an opportunity to discuss any concerns.

    Immunizations

    Vaccinations protect children from serious illnesses. Follow the recommended immunization schedule to ensure your child is protected against diseases like measles, mumps, rubella, and whooping cough.

    Healthy Habits: Building a Foundation for Life

    Instilling healthy habits early in life can set the stage for a lifetime of well-being. Here are some habits to encourage:

    Hygiene Practices

    Teach children the importance of good hygiene, such as regular handwashing, dental care, and personal cleanliness. These practices can prevent infections and promote overall health.

    Sleep Routine

    Adequate sleep is crucial for children’s physical and mental development. Establish a consistent bedtime routine and ensure children get the recommended amount of sleep for their age.
